Championship Off-Road Racing 2007 Rounds 1 & 2

CORR 2007

 Corr Logo

Championship Off-Road Racing, better known simply as CORR, has returned for it's third season in Southern California. This year brings CORR to 5 All-New Tracks for 7 weekends and 14 rounds of exciting racing! The new tracks will be located in Antelope Valley, Pomona, and Chula Vista California, Las Vegas Nevada, and the Texas Motor Speedway.

Along with the all new tracks there is other big news this season for CORR. Biggest being that this season's Jason Baldwin Memorial Cup Qualifiers (one race for Pro-2 and one for Pro-4 per weekend) will be televised on NBC! See below for the full television schedule, including showings on SPEED.

CORR has also added two new full-time classes. After the highly successful debut of Trophy Karts last year in Chula Vista they are now running a full series! Also new to CORR this year is UTV's, Side by Side's, Rhinos, whatever you call them, they are cool!
